The Emotional Rollercoaster of Wellness Creation

The first time I hosted an online workshop, my excitement was palpable. Connecting with like-minded individuals fueled my preparation. The instant feedback during the session, the nods, smiles, and comments, was exhilarating. Yet, post-event, I faced unexpected emptiness. The adrenaline waned, leaving self-doubt and exhaustion.

This cycle is familiar to many wellness creators. The initial euphoria of launching a new initiative gives way to pressure and isolation. These emotions are amplified in the digital age where we constantly compare our journeys with seemingly more successful peers. Remember, these feelings are normal but must be managed effectively.

Tips for Preventing Burnout

Avoiding burnout requires intention and strategy:

  • Delegate: As your community grows, so do your responsibilities. Consider hiring a virtual assistant or collaborating with other creators to share the load. Check out how Harnessing Collaboration for Exponential Growth can expand your reach while lightening your workload.
  • Set Realistic Goals: It’s easy to get caught up in ambitious targets that may not be instantly achievable. Break down goals into manageable tasks and celebrate small victories along the way.
  • Embrace Self-Care Routines: Regularly schedule time away from screens to recharge physically and mentally, whether it’s through yoga, meditation, or simply enjoying nature.
